I regrettably purchased a Hay Hut two years ago. Two months ago the thing just started to fall apart. I think they can't handle the cold weather. The top shattered when I slid it over a new hay bail and the bottom corners are breaking off. Our two horses are not destructive and did not cause any damage. I wish I knew what junk these things are and I would have saved my self $700. I contacted hayhuts.com and they just told me it was out of warranty and they could not do anything.
